The same pine grove in Xàbia has suffered its third fire this summer. The rapid intervention of Civil Protection and firefighters has managed to extinguish the flames and prevent their spread, leaving it as a minor incident.

The pine grove located in the Lluca and Tarraula areas, near the Camí Vell de Teulada, has been the scene of the third summer fire. The repetition of these events has generated suspicions about their possible intentionality.
The response from Civil Protection of Xàbia, as well as firefighters and the Local Police of Xàbia and Benitatxell, has been immediate on all occasions. Their swift action has allowed the flames to be extinguished before they could cause major damage or spread through the dense vegetation.
This type of incident keeps the town on alert, especially during the summer months, when drought and high temperatures increase the risk of forest fires. The affected pine grove is considered a sensitive spot during this period.
